Derek Fisher Suspended One Game

Derek Fisher
Laker's guard Derek Fisher has been suspended by the NBA for Friday's game 3 against the Houston Rockets at Houston. He bodychecked Rockets forward Luis Scola in the waning minutes of the third quarter that was a ruled a flagrant-two foul resulting in an ejection. Kobe Bryant's elbow to Ron Artest in the fourth quarter was upgraded to a flagrant-one foul and will not result in any suspension.
